Restart your PC and see if you get the error … Web4 mrt. 2024 · To Reset Task Manager to Defaults in Windows 10, Close the Task Manager if you have it running. Open the Start menu, and locate the Task Manager shortcut. Press and hold the keys Alt, Shift, and Ctrl. While holding the keys, click on the Task Manager shortcut. Voila, it will start with defaults! Also, there is a an alternative …

In the Task Scheduler window, go to the Actions column … how many children does andrew shue haveWeb19 aug. 2024 · Search task scheduler in Windows search. Right-click on Task Scheduler and click New Folder and give a name to the folder like Server Reboot and click OK. Making a folder makes your tasks separate, so you can manage easily. Now right-click on new created folder and select Create Task.
